Tchaikovsky: Violin Concerto op.35 & Romeo and Juliet Fantasy Overture

Violinist Alena Baeve and the Düsseldorfer Symphoniker Orchestra

Conducted by Alexandre Bloch

They perform Tchaikovsky’s Violin Concerto op.35 and the Fantasy Overture from Romeo and Juliet (37:15) at the Concertgebouw Amsterdam.

Musicians: Düsseldorfer Symphoniker

Alexandre Bloch [conductor]

Alena Baeva [violin]

Musical programme:
1. P.I. Tsjaikovsky – Violin Concerto, Op. 35 (from start)
2. P.I. Tsjaikovsky – Fantasie-overture Romeo and Juliet (37:15)

Rhapsody in Blue

Yes, piano – again!

Leonard Bernstein conducts the New York Philharmonic and plays piano in a performance of George Gershwin’s Rhapsody in Blue at the Royal Albert Hall in 1976.
